253
|
1 # molko_define_test |
|
2 |
|
3 Create unit test. |
|
4 |
|
5 ## Synopsis |
|
6 |
|
7 ```cmake |
|
8 molko_define_test( |
|
9 TARGET target name |
|
10 SOURCES src1, src2, srcn |
|
11 ASSETS (Optional) list of assets to build |
|
12 FLAGS (Optional) C flags (without -D) |
|
13 LIBRARIES (Optional) libraries to link |
|
14 INCLUDES (Optional) includes |
|
15 ) |
|
16 ``` |
|
17 |
|
18 Create an executable with the name *TARGET* and a test case of the same name |
|
19 with the given *SOURCES*. |
|
20 |
|
21 Optional include paths, libraries and flags can be specified via *INCLUDES*, |
|
22 *LIBRARIES* and *FLAGS* arguments respectively. |
|
23 |
|
24 If argument *ASSETS* is set, they are generated in the target binary |
|
25 directory. |
|
26 |